Share via


ReportingTask 类

定义

public ref class ReportingTask : Microsoft::SqlServer::Management::DatabaseMaintenance::DatabaseMaintenanceBaseTask, Microsoft::SqlServer::Dts::Runtime::IDTSComponentPersist, Microsoft::SqlServer::Management::DatabaseMaintenance::IContextSelection, Microsoft::SqlServer::Management::DatabaseMaintenance::IReportingTaskInterface
[Microsoft.SqlServer.Dts.Runtime.DtsTask(RequiredProductLevel=Microsoft.SqlServer.Dts.Runtime.DTSProductLevel.None, TaskContact="Maintenance Plan Reporting Task; Microsoft Corporation; Microsoft SQL Server v9; � 2004 Microsoft Corporation; All Rights Reserved;http://www.microsoft.com/sql/support/default.asp;1", TaskType="NOTOOLBOX")]
public class ReportingTask : Microsoft.SqlServer.Management.DatabaseMaintenance.DatabaseMaintenanceBaseTask, Microsoft.SqlServer.Dts.Runtime.IDTSComponentPersist, Microsoft.SqlServer.Management.DatabaseMaintenance.IContextSelection, Microsoft.SqlServer.Management.DatabaseMaintenance.IReportingTaskInterface
[<Microsoft.SqlServer.Dts.Runtime.DtsTask(RequiredProductLevel=Microsoft.SqlServer.Dts.Runtime.DTSProductLevel.None, TaskContact="Maintenance Plan Reporting Task; Microsoft Corporation; Microsoft SQL Server v9; � 2004 Microsoft Corporation; All Rights Reserved;http://www.microsoft.com/sql/support/default.asp;1", TaskType="NOTOOLBOX")>]
type ReportingTask = class
    inherit DatabaseMaintenanceBaseTask
    interface IReportingTaskInterface
    interface IContextSelection
    interface IDTSComponentPersist
Public Class ReportingTask
Inherits DatabaseMaintenanceBaseTask
Implements IContextSelection, IDTSComponentPersist, IReportingTaskInterface
继承
属性
实现

构造函数

ReportingTask()

属性

BypassPrepare

获取或设置一个布尔值,该值指示在将 SQL 语句发送到关系数据库管理系统 (RDBMS) 时执行 SQL 任务是否跳过语句的准备。

(继承自 ExecuteSQLTask)
CodePage

获取或设置在将存储为 Unicode 宽字节的变量值转换为多字节时使用的代码页。 转换或者在将值存储到数据库时发生,或者在从数据库提取值时发生。

(继承自 ExecuteSQLTask)
Connection

获取或设置连接到执行 SQL 任务在其中运行的关系数据库管理系统 (RDBMS) 的连接管理器的名称。

(继承自 ExecuteSQLTask)
CreateNewFile
DatabaseSelectionType (继承自 DatabaseMaintenanceBaseTask)
EmailReport
ExecutionValue

返回某个或某些 SQL 语句影响的行数。

(继承自 ExecuteSQLTask)
ExtendedLogging (继承自 DatabaseMaintenanceBaseTask)
GenerateTextReport
IgnoreDatabasesInNotOnlineState (继承自 DatabaseMaintenanceBaseTask)
IsStoredProcedure

获取或设置一个布尔值,该值指示执行 SQL 任务指定的 SQL 语句是否为存储过程。

(继承自 ExecuteSQLTask)
LocalConnectionForLogging (继承自 DatabaseMaintenanceBaseTask)
LogRemote
ObjectTypeSelection (继承自 DatabaseMaintenanceBaseTask)
OperatorName
ParameterBindings

返回一个实现 IDTSParameterBindings 的对象。

(继承自 ExecuteSQLTask)
Path
ProxyAccountName
RemoteConnectionName
ResultSetBindings

返回一个实现 IDTSParameterBindings 的对象。

(继承自 ExecuteSQLTask)
ResultSetType

获取或设置一个值,该值指示执行 SQL 任务运行的 SQL 语句返回的结果集的类型。

(继承自 ExecuteSQLTask)
RunId (继承自 DatabaseMaintenanceBaseTask)
SelectedDatabases (继承自 DatabaseMaintenanceBaseTask)
SelectedTables (继承自 DatabaseMaintenanceBaseTask)
SequenceId
ServerVersion (继承自 DatabaseMaintenanceBaseTask)
SqlBatchCommands (继承自 DatabaseMaintenanceBaseTask)
SqlStatementSource

获取或设置包含执行 SQL 任务运行的 SQL 语句的源的名称。

(继承自 ExecuteSQLTask)
SqlStatementSourceType

获取或设置一个值,该值指示包含执行 SQL 任务运行的 SQL 语句的源的类型。

(继承自 ExecuteSQLTask)
TableSelectionType (继承自 DatabaseMaintenanceBaseTask)
TargetServerVersion (继承自 Task)
TaskAllowesDatbaseSelection
TaskAllowesTableSelection
TaskConnectionName (继承自 DatabaseMaintenanceBaseTask)
TaskName (继承自 DatabaseMaintenanceBaseTask)
TaskNameWasModified (继承自 DatabaseMaintenanceBaseTask)
TimeOut

获取或设置一个整数,该整数指示任务最长经过多少秒数后才超时。

(继承自 ExecuteSQLTask)
TypeConversionMode

获取或设置执行 SQL 任务使用的转换模式。

(继承自 ExecuteSQLTask)
Version

*** 不推荐使用的成员;请参阅“备注”。 *** 返回任务的版本。 此属性为只读。

(继承自 Task)

方法

CanDowngradeTo(Int32) (继承自 DatabaseMaintenanceBaseTask)
CanUpdate(String)

*** 不推荐使用的成员;请参阅“备注”。 指示新包 XML 是否可以更新旧包 XML 的布尔值。

(继承自 Task)
CopyTo(DatabaseMaintenanceBaseTask) (继承自 DatabaseMaintenanceBaseTask)
DowngradeTo(Int32, XmlElement) (继承自 DatabaseMaintenanceBaseTask)
Equals(Object)

确定两个对象实例是否相等。

(继承自 DtsObject)
Execute(Connections, VariableDispenser, IDTSComponentEvents, IDTSLogging, Object)
GetConnectionID(Connections, String)

获取包含连接 ID 的字符串。

(继承自 Task)
GetConnectionName(Connections, String)

获取包含连接名称的字符串。

(继承自 Task)
GetHashCode()

返回此实例的哈希代码。

(继承自 DtsObject)
InitializeTask(Connections, VariableDispenser, IDTSInfoEvents, IDTSLogging, EventInfos, LogEntryInfos, ObjectReferenceTracker) (继承自 DatabaseMaintenanceBaseTask)
LoadFromXML(XmlElement, IDTSInfoEvents)
OnAddedToTaskHost(TaskHost) (继承自 DatabaseMaintenanceBaseTask)
SaveToXML(XmlDocument, IDTSInfoEvents)
Update(String)

*** 不推荐使用的成员;请参阅“备注”。 此方法使用新包 XML 更新旧包 XML(如果 CanUpdate(String) 设置为 true)。

(继承自 Task)
Validate(Connections, VariableDispenser, IDTSComponentEvents, IDTSLogging) (继承自 DatabaseMaintenanceBaseTask)
WriteToDTSLog(IDTSLogging, String) (继承自 DatabaseMaintenanceBaseTask)

适用于